A penthouse at the View — thought to be the priciest condominium ever to hit the Queens market, as The Real Deal first reported — is in contract, Curbed wrote.

The three-bedroom, four-bathroom unit at Long Island City luxury development the View had an asking price of $3.25 million, though the sales price was not disclosed. Nestseekers’ Silvette Julian had the listing.

This penthouse (one of nine) features private outdoor space, granite counter tops, Italian marble in the bathrooms and hardwood floors throughout the 2,260-square-foot apartment.

Last year’s most expensive Queens condo sale was another penthouse at the View, which sold for $1.66 million, according to Propertyshark.com.
